I am trying to plan a daytrip by ferry from Dover-Calais, we are going as foot passengers so i'm after information really about what to do at Calais, how good is public transport? Where are my options to visit etc? And timescales.

It has been a few years since we went over on foot. However there are regular buses run by the ferry companies into the town centre. They were free last time I went but that was a few years back. The big hypermarkets are on the outskirts of town and you will need a bus or taxi to get to them. There are smaller supermarkets in the town. There is one on the far side of the market square. These will be cheaper than at home but probably not as cheap or with as large a selection than the hypers. There is an Auchan at Coquelles which is on a bus route. I don't know if buses go to the Cite de Europe. The Auchan has other shops and cafes and there is a large wine warehouse in the same complex. However you are limited by what you can carry.
Must admit I don't go to Calais for the culture but there is a very good war museum in the park opposite the town hall. There are several nice restaurants which I assume will be open at this time.
